Try CasePortal for FreeJ. Stras finds a lower court properly dismissed a railroad employee's race discrimination claims against Union Pacific. The railroad employee argued that she was passed over for a promotion two times because she is Hispanic and over 40- years- old. However, the railroad company presented sufficient evidence in court that her faxed resume was not a job application, and that the proper avenue to apply for an internal job would have been over a workforce management tool. Affirmed.
